  • Patent number: 11532032
    Abstract: The disclosure relates to technology for determining locations of approaching recipients of online pre-requested or pre-ordered goods/services. Physical waiting queues and/or wait-lists are managed so that the goods/services will be provided without excessive wait times or unacceptably long wait lines or inferior quality in the provided goods/services. Resolution of location determination becomes finer and finer in one embodiment as the recipients get closer to the provisioning spot. If there is a change of plans, the recipients are notified ahead of time so as to avoid last minute surprises or disappointments.

  • Patent number: 10034228
    Abstract: The system and method of the present disclosure relates to technology for monitoring a broadcast device that is non-network connected. A wireless device monitors for a broadcast message transmitted wirelessly by the broadcast device. Upon discovery of the broadcast message, the wireless device transmits information from the broadcast message to a remotely located sever via a network. The server stores the broadcast information and determines the status (e.g., online or offline) of the broadcast device. The status is determined based on the detection time (e.g., the last seen time of the broadcast device by the wireless device) and an offline threshold value (e.g., a predetermined time period) that is compared to the current time or time upon which the server received the broadcast information. As a result of the comparison, the server determines whether the broadcast device is online or offline.
